LG reviews SANJY arrangements at Pantha Chowk

Srinagar, July 9: Lieutenant Governor Manoj Sinha on Thursday visited the Pantha Chowk Yatri Niwas and Yatra Transit Camp in Srinagar to assess the facilities and arrangements put in place for the ongoing Shri Amarnath Ji Yatra.

During the visit, the Lieutenant Governor conducted a detailed review of accommodation, registration, security, sanitation, medical facilities, food services and other essential arrangements for the pilgrims.

He directed the concerned officers to ensure that every devotee undertaking the holy pilgrimage receives round-the-clock assistance and care throughout their stay. Stressing the importance of seamless coordination among all departments, the Lieutenant Governor instructed officials to leave no room for inconvenience to pilgrims at any stage of the Yatra.

Manoj Sinha emphasized that from registration to boarding, lodging, food and other essential services, every aspect of the pilgrimage should be managed efficiently to provide devotees with a safe, comfortable and hassle-free experience.

The Lieutenant Governor also called upon the officials to remain vigilant, responsive and committed to maintaining high standards of public service so that all pilgrims visiting the holy Amarnath Cave Shrine can undertake the sacred journey with ease and confidence.
